The music video was directed by Jason Zada and allows viewers "To Explore Trey's Fantasies" by selecting different objects as they're prompted in the video to get to the next sequence of the video.

It's a super seductive and intriguing music video.

BuzzFeed spoke with Songz about the choice to make the video interactive. He said, "I have a personal connection with my fans and I wanted this interactive video to be a way for them to get a glimpse into my world and my fantasies in a new way."

In the music video Minaj delivers her verse while sitting on a throne.
